Man Utd benefit from Ole Gunnar Solskjaer going out of his way to block transfer

Manchester United have enjoyed an encouraging start to the season under new boss Erik ten Hag, with Diogo Dalot a growing presence in the Red Devils squad

Manchester United’s summer transfer window in 2021 was one punctuated by blockbuster, headline-making deals.

Jadon Sancho arrived for £73million, Raphael Varane signed from Real Madrid with a pedigree which came before him and Cristiano Ronaldo …well is Cristiano Ronaldo. Just over a year later – for one reason or another – each of those deals are viewed somewhat less positively than they were at time.

But Ole Gunnar Solskjaer ‘s least heralded decision from that summer continues to reap the rewards for the Red Devils – even after the Norwegian’s dismissal. Having spent the previous season out on loan with AC Milan, Diogo Dalot was expected to be afforded another move in search of regular minutes.

Once tipped to be the next Gary Neville, the Portuguese full-back looked to be a player failing to live up to his potential. Dalot had performed well with the Rossoneri and there was interest to take him back to the San Siro.
